    Italy Type 1 Diabetes Treatment Market Summary

    As per MRFR analysis, the type 1 diabetes treatment market size was estimated at 262.55 USD Million in 2024. The type 1-diabetes-treatment market is projected to grow from 278.38 USD Million in 2025 to 499.7 USD Million by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.03% during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

    The Italy Type 1 Diabetes Treatment Market is diversifying through its Treatment Type segment, reflecting a comprehensive approach to managing this chronic condition. Within this segment, Insulin Therapy remains a cornerstone as insulin is essential for Type 1 diabetes patients.

    It not only helps in regulating blood sugar levels but also plays a vital role in preventing complications associated with diabetes. Continuous Glucose Monitoring is gaining traction as an advanced method for monitoring glucose levels, providing real-time data to patients and healthcare providers, thereby facilitating informed decision-making and personalized treatment plans.

    This technology improves the quality of life for patients by enabling tighter control over their glucose levels. Another significant aspect of the market is Insulin Pump Therapy, which offers patients the flexibility of administering insulin in a more controlled manner.

    This method can enhance patient adherence to treatment regimens and lead to better overall health outcomes. Furthermore, Immunotherapy is emerging as an innovative approach, targeting the underlying autoimmune response that leads to Type 1 diabetes, indicating potential for disease-modifying treatments in the future.

    The Route of Administration segment within the Italy Type 1 Diabetes Treatment Market displays a significant landscape characterized by key methodologies such as Subcutaneous, Intravenous, and Inhalation methods.

    In Italy, healthcare initiatives have emphasized innovative delivery mechanisms, driving the adoption of Subcutaneous routes, particularly through insulin pumps and pens, which are favored for their convenience and simplicity in patient use.

    Meanwhile, Intravenous administration remains essential in acute treatment settings, allowing for rapid blood sugar regulation, critical for patients facing severe hyperglycemia or diabetic ketoacidosis. The Inhalation route, while less common, is gaining traction as a non-invasive alternative, appealing to patients who prefer avoiding injections.

    The Age Group segment of the Italy Type 1 Diabetes Treatment Market presents an insightful distribution that caters specifically to the distinct needs of Children, Adolescents, and Adults. This segmentation is crucial as each age group experiences unique challenges and treatment requirements.

    Children often face the challenge of adhering to treatment regimes implemented by parents and healthcare providers, making support systems and education vital. Adolescents, on the other hand, confront issues related to lifestyle management and the transition to self-management of their condition, highlighting the importance of tailored educational programs and monitoring.

    Adults typically dominate this segment due to the higher prevalence of Type 1 Diabetes in this demographic, as they balance daily life and disease management while navigating healthcare resources.
